Notes
'Recorded at Marcus Music AB, London'. (back cover)
'Mastered at Strawberry'. (back cover)
A special 180 GM remastered vinyl edition. Pressing is limited to 5000, the first 2000 being numbered. Remastered from the original tapes, each album features a picture label on the A side, with a heavyweight inner bag and the original sleeve printed on a heavyweight 350g double white heavy board (square cornered).
℗1979 Beggars Banquet Records Ltd. under license to Vinyl 180 (back cover, labels)
© 2008 Beggars Banquet Records Ltd. under license to Vinyl 180 (back cover, labels)
'All songs © 1979. All rights reserved. Lyrics by kind permission.' 'All songs written by Gary Numan.' (inside sleeve)
'All songs published by Universal Music Publishing Ltd./ Momentum 3' (back cover)
'Made in England'. (labels, back cover)
Runout Groove: 'Play Now Loud'. (Side A)

Phenomenal sound as to be expected from the Vinyl 180 label. To me, this is the pressing to own. I own a very clean original Beggars Banquet pressing and I still prefer the sound on this pressing. Highly recommended.
